February 12

Stars: Morena Baccarin, Ryan Reynolds, Gina Carano
Directed By: Tim Miller
Synopsis: A former Special Forces operative turned mercenary is subjected to a rogue experiment that leaves him with accelerated healing powers, adopting the alter ego Deadpool.
Our Two Cents: Looks like so much despicable fun.
